Rasterization Performance
Rasterization remains the foundation of graphics card performance. Models like the ASRock Intel Arc B580 Challenger deliver strong frame rates in traditional rendering pipelines according to manufacturer specifications.
Ray Tracing Performance
Ray tracing capabilities vary significantly across the 15 options. NVIDIA-based cards generally lead in this area based on published performance data when compared with competing models.
VRAM Capacity
VRAM is critical for high-resolution gaming and content creation. Several cards in this guide offer 16GB or more, providing future-proofing for demanding titles and workloads.
Power Consumption
Power efficiency affects both electricity costs and cooling requirements. Low-power options like the Sparkle Intel Arc A310 ECO are ideal for compact builds while higher-end models may require robust power supplies.
Upscaling Technologies
Technologies such as DLSS and FSR enhance performance without sacrificing too much image quality. Cards supporting the latest versions give you an edge in modern games.
Cooling Design
Effective cooling ensures sustained performance. Dual-fan and blower designs appear throughout the lineup, with some featuring 0dB silent modes for quiet operation.

How to Compare GPUs Before Buying
The best GPU depends on resolution, refresh rate, game type, power budget, and price. A graphics card should be judged by real benchmarks at your target resolution, not only by model name or memory size.
For 1080p gaming, mid-range GPUs can be enough. For 1440p, more GPU power and VRAM become important. For 4K, you should prioritize high-end performance, upscaling support, and enough memory for modern textures.
What to Check
- Average FPS and 1% low results.
- VRAM capacity and memory bandwidth.
- Ray tracing performance if you use it.
- Power draw and PSU requirements.
- Cooler quality and case fit.
Value Tips
- Compare price per frame.
- Do not overbuy for a low-refresh monitor.
- Check game-specific benchmarks.
- Consider used and previous-gen pricing carefully.
A good GPU purchase is about balance. Choose the card that fits your monitor, games, and budget rather than chasing the most expensive option.
